4th July – 27th September 2026
A collaborative exhibition between Henshaws Arts and Crafts Centre & Pyramid of Arts, building on the success of previous exhibitions with disabled and neurodivergent artists at the Mills. This will be an immersive take-over of the Gallery and artists from both groups will be responding to the theme of magic. Think magicians’ hats, wizards, mythical creatures, spells and illusions.

ZINE LIBRARY OPEN CALL
We are looking for artists to apply to exhibit their zines in our newly established zine library, curated alongside each Gallery exhibition. The zines will sit alongside a collection of comics, zines and artists’ books by artists from both organisations.
Through this open call, we hope to hear from a range of voices. If selected, your work be seen by thousands of visitors throughout the course of the exhibition and may be featured on our social media with a reach of 30,000+ followers.
Eligibility:
This open call is open at any artist based in the UK & Ireland, who is able to deliver or post their zine to the Gallery in Farsley, Leeds, LS28 5UJ. We will be accepting work that is for sale in limited or unlimited runs, one-off artists’ books and books that are not for sale.
Accepted formats:
Photographic or illustrative zines or self published books
Artists’ books
Poetry or prose books / pamphlets
Dummy / prototype books
Relevant themes:
Magic
Fantasy
Card tricks
Magical spaces & environments
Storytelling
